A famous Jain Pilgrimage Temple of Ghantakrana Mahavir. Well maintained and managed. Well connected with Good Conditions of Roads. Ample of parking space available. Sukhdi (a sweet preparation of wheat and Ghee) available as Prasad(which is required to be consumed in premises only). Jain Food Facilities available. Accomodation only for Jains.

The place is clean, beautiful and well kept. No entry ticket needed. Big parking area behind the temple. Lunch available for pay and eat inside the temple campus. Place to stay is available. This is a Jain temple though open for all. There are free auto rides inside the temple for elderly or people who have problem in walking. Many seating area inside the temple campus. There is a river which is 1.7kms away from the temple which can be visited by walking through the Mahudi village. Approach road to mandir is also good. Parking is free and wheelchair accessible.

Actually this place needs no introduction, have actually grown up visiting this place mostly once every year since last 15yrs at least.
Even visited after 1st covid wave when there were many restrictions and no live sukhdi (which is the main prasad here) just a small prasad in the exit queue and the famous ghantakarn mahavir temple and 24 tirthankar tirth.
As on 20 Aug 21, live sukhdi is available with little restrictions in temple visit and of course the 24 tirthankar darshan is closed since covid and as mentioned by authorities and will be till dec 21 as renovation is carried out.
Bhojanshala has started and we had lunch, same taste, even live sukhdi is same before covid.
They keep on changing parking exits this time exit was from main entrance and entry from back entry as usual changed around 5yrs or so ago.
